20080271612 | STEAM COOKER AND RELATED SUPERHEATER - A steam cooker includes a steam generator including a heating chamber defining a volume for holding water. A heat exchanger is associated with the heating chamber so as to generate steam. A steam superheater superheats steam traveling from the heating chamber to a steam cooking chamber. | 11-06-2008 |
20090071346 | STEAM COOKING APPARATUS WITH STEAM FLUSHING SYSTEM - A steam cooking system includes a steam cooking chamber having an access door and a drain for draining condensate from the steam cooking chamber along a drain path. A steam generator unit heats water to generate steam. The steam generator unit is connected for delivery of steam from the steam generator to the steam cooking chamber via a first steam path during a cooking operation. The steam generator unit is also connected for delivery of steam from the steam generator to the drain path via a second steam path during a steam flushing operation. | 03-19-2009 |

20110049123 | STEAM OVEN HEATER PLATE ARRANGEMENT - A steam oven includes a cooking cavity for receiving food product and a water reservoir for receiving water to be heated to generate steam, the water reservoir defined in part by a bottom wall structure of the cooking cavity. A heater plate located adjacent the bottom wall structure delivers heat through the bottom wall structure to water in the water reservoir. A spring-loaded heater plate mount arrangement supports the heater plate adjacent the bottom wall structure while permitting some movement of the heater plate. | 03-03-2011 |
20130220301 | GAS BURNER SYSTEM FOR GAS-POWERED COOKING DEVICES - A food cooking device includes a cooking structure defining a volume for receiving food product to be cooked, and a heating arrangement for heating food product within the volume. The heating arrangement includes a gas burner system that includes a blower and fuel gas flow feed device arranged such that operation of the blower draws in ambient air and the flow of ambient air through the blower in turn draws fuel gas from the fuel gas flow control device such that a ratio of fuel gas to ambient air remains substantially the same regardless of blower speed. A burner is connected to receive the fuel gas and ambient air mixture from the blower. A controller is connected for controlling blower speed, the controller configured to vary the blower speed between at least two different non-zero blower speeds. | 08-29-2013 |

20080275941 | Service Integration on a Network - Described are computer-based methods and apparatuses, including computer program products, for service integration on a network. Telecommunication services (e.g., calendar, television, phone, location) on a network are integrated using service codelets designed to interface with the services. A default codelet associated with the user (e.g., via a service plan) dynamically calls the service codelets to request information from the associated services (e.g., calendar data) and/or perform tasks with the associated services (e.g., update calendar). The service codelets can dynamically call other service codelets based on the results of their requests for information. The information from the services is integrated and returned to the user. | 11-06-2008 |

20090041022 | FRAME RELAY SWITCHED DATA SERVICE - A new type of data transport service which uses a frame relay layer 2 data link connection identifier (DLCI) to select among various service types, feature sets, and/or closed user groups (CUGs). A layer 3 address may be extracted from a layer 2 frame, and the layer 3 address information may be used to route a data packet over a packet-switched network according to the service classes, feature sets, and/or CUGs selected. At the destination, the layer 3 data packet may again be enclosed in a layer 2 frame with a DLCI indicating the service classes, features sets, and/or CUGs. Because the use of conventional permanent virtual circuits (PVCs) is not required in aspects of the invention, new methods of measuring and managing network traffic are presented. | 02-12-2009 |
